She's not going against the law at all here. All Thamnophis species in Arizona have a 4 count bag limit per year. As far as what you do with them, thats up to the collector... There's no law against that either. If that were the case, I wouldn't have had half of the stuff I've had.

I wish I could see the darn thing, but the pics aren't showing up! Allison, you'd be surprised to see how far north some of the checkereds can make it. I found some up by San Fran peaks one summer.

Has he/sh/it started eating for you? A word of the wise (if you go the fish route)... stay away from Goldfish and stick to Minnows. Or go buy him a trout and slice off itty bitty pieces for him. Good luck with him, and I hope to see it soon! If you need help, let me know. We're not that far away
